As we get in > the DWARF_VALUE_STACK case (line 1028 of dwarf2/expr.c), the `len` > variable is therefore set to 0, instead of the actual type length. We > then call allocate_value on subobj_type, which does call check_typedef, > so the length of the typedef gets filled in at that point. We end up > passing to the copy function a source array view of length 0 and a > target array view of length 4, and the assertion fails. > > Fix this by calling check_typedef on both type and subobj_type at the > beginning of fetch_result. > > I tried writing a test for this using the DWARF assembler, but I haven't > succeeded. It's possible that we need to get into this specific code > path (value_of_dwarf_reg_entry and all) to manage to get to > dwarf_expr_context::fetch_result with a typedef type that has never been > resolved. In all my attempts, the typedef would always be resolved > already, so the bug wouldn't show up. > > As a fallback, I made a gdb.dwarf2 test with a compiler-generated .S > file. I don't particularly like those, but I think it's better than no > test.
